Waste — Emissions (CO2eq) from CH4 in Central America
Central America: Waste — Emissions (CO2eq) from CH4 was 79,060 kt in 2023. ▲ Rising
Waste — Emissions (CO2eq) from CH4 in Central America, 1961–2023
Source: Food and Agriculture Organization of the United Nations. Measured in kt.
Analysis
The most recent figure for waste — emissions (co2eq) from ch4 in Central America is 79,060 kt, measured in 2023. That is the highest value across all 63 years on record.
The figure is up 1.6% on the previous year and up 21.4% over ten years.
Over the whole period, waste — emissions (co2eq) from ch4 in Central America peaked at 79,060 kt in 2023 and was at its lowest, 11,504 kt, in 1961.
Central America ranks 19th of 32 groups on this measure, in the middle of the range.
The long-run direction has been consistently rising across the 63 years of available data.

About this data
The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
